The Role
The Controller owns the entire accounting function and is the second finance leader, working directly alongside the Head of Finance.
You will own the books across all entities (US, UK, India), the month-end close and consolidations, technical accounting (606, 842, 718), revenue, COGS and inventory, and internal controls, and you will run and complete our external audit. You will manage the tax, statutory, and specialist work, and you will manage and grow the accounting team.
To start, this is a player-coach seat. It is you and one accountant, so you run and review the close yourself and own the technical work directly, then hire and build the team over the next 12 to 18 months. You need to be as comfortable in the details as you are leading.
Just as important, you will help build an AI-first accounting function. We already run much of the transactional layer on automation, and we want a Controller who treats that as core to the job, not a side project. This is a rare seat for a strong technical accountant who wants to build the accounting org of the future on a small, senior, high-leverage team, with room to grow in scope as we scale through a Series C to $50M+ ARR.
Skills and qualifications:
7+ years of progressive accounting experience, or an Accounting Manager / Assistant Controller ready to step up into a full controllership. We are betting on slope, not just tenure
Non-negotiable: you have independently owned a month-end close, handled real revenue recognition (ASC 606), and been through an audit. This seat cannot be someone's first time doing any of the three
Hardware experience required. You have done the accounting for a company that ships physical product, so inventory, COGS, and hardware revenue and bundling are familiar ground, not a learning curve
A strong technical accountant: hands-on with US GAAP, revenue recognition (ASC 606) and consolidations, ideally also leases (842), stock-based comp (718), and capitalized software
CPA preferred, but not required. What is not optional is technical depth and audit experience
Audit experience, internal or external. You know what a clean audit actually takes
Experience owning or heavily contributing to a multi-entity month-end close and consolidations
Has been part of selecting and implementing an ERP. We will graduate off QuickBooks as we scale, and having done that before is a real plus
Has built and managed a team, and raised the bar on the people around them
AI-forward and genuinely AI-pilled: already using automation and AI in accounting, with a point of view on how a modern accounting org should be built
Multi-entity or international experience (UK/India), and a high-growth startup background
